Actually each Order is set up to be a working coven in that area. However, we as the head of each order, must evaluate potential members and get them through the Gateway course, kind of like the "outer circle" of a coven. Once you've completed Gateway you can initiate (or have the leader initiate you) into Ar Afalon. Then you would be a full fledged member of the coven/order. That's my understanding from my talking with Lady Calliean, the Founding Mother of Ar Afalon.
